Mabel Dodge Luhan Part 2: Peyote Party at Mabel's House!
Artists, politicians, and revolutionaries? Oh my! As we continue on with the life of Mabel Dodge Luhan, we find Mabel leaving Europe, where she first encountered the Stein siblings, Leo and Gertrude, and coming home to New York. It's here that Mabel will first establish a name for herself by hosting intellectual "Evenings" at her apartment at 53 Fifth Avenue, Manhattan. Tune in to find out what life had in store next for Mabel Dodge Luhan. (Ep. 002)

Mabel Dodge Luhan Part 1: Birth of a Mover and Shaker.
In our first series, we'll be covering the life of an often forgotten character in history named Mabel Dodge Luhan. An American writer, advocate for Native American rights, and patron of the arts, Mabel spent the later half of her life in Taos, New Mexico, where she established something of an art retreat that helped inspire artists like Georgia O’Keefe, Ansel Adams, Willa Cather, Mary Austin, Marsden Hatley, Andrew Dasberg, and D.H. Lawrence. Join us in this five-part series as we explore the adventurous, passionate, and often times hilarious life of Mabel Dodge Luhan. (Ep. 001)
